Graft-versus-host disease (GvHD) is a serious problem after transplantation. GvHD can be mild and rare, but it can also be severe, permanent, and even fatal.

To ensure graft engraftment and prevent graft-versus-host disease, Baby cord blood is always perfect for a baby. Immediate family members are also more likely to match the stored cord blood. Siblings have a 25% chance of being a perfect match and a 50% chance of being a partial match. Parents who give half the markers used in the pairing have a 100% chance of being a partial match.
